Kayak Point is a census-designated place (CDP) located in Snohomish County, Washington, United States. The CDP was newly defined by the United States Census Bureau in 2013.[3] The population was 1,737 as of 2013 estimates.

It is home to Kayak Point County Park as well as a golf course.

Geography

Kayak Point is located at coordinates 48°08′33″N 122°20′32″W / 48.14250°N 122.34222°W / 48.14250; -122.34222 (48.142508, -122.342276).[4]

According to the United States Census Bureau, the CDP has a total area of 5.485 square miles (14.2 km²), of which, 5.474 square miles (14.2 km²) of it is land and 0.011 square miles (0.03 km²) of it (0.20%) is water.
